For the first time, progress on child survival is going backwards. A child dies every six seconds from something we already know how to prevent. But when we get this right, children don’t just survive, they thrive and grow into adults who build stronger futures for themselves and their countries.

In 2027, Britain hosts the G20: a chance to fix a financial system that fails to invest in the next generation, leaving many countries spending more on debt repayments than on health and education combined.
